## Models & Ratings 

|Output Voltage|Output Power<br>Output Voltage Trim|Output Voltage Trim(3)|Output Current|Peak Current(2)|Typical Efficiency(1)|Model Number|
|---|---|---|---|---|---|---|
|12 V|100 W|12.0-14.0 V|8.33 A|12.5 A|89.5%|DSR120PS12|
|24 V|120 W|24.0-28.0 V|5.0 A|7.5 A|91.0%|DSR120PS24|
|48 V|120 W|48.0-56.0 V|2.5 A|3.75 A|92.0%|DSR120PS48|



## ~~**Notes**~~ 

_1. Typical efficiency at 230 VAC and full load._ 

_2. Peak current is for a maximum of 3 s, see Application Notes. Average power is not to exceed nominal output power._ 

_3. Output current should be limited so that nominal output power is not exceeded._

A peak load can be used for a certain period after which the output goes into overload mode. Overload operation is trip and restart. The peak load duration depends on the value of the load, e.g. a peak load of 150% can be taken for approximately 3s. After this time the output will turn off for approximately 7s before turning back on. 

If the load has reduced to 100% or less than normal operation is resumed. If the load remains at 150% then the output is maintained for a further 3s before turning off for 7s. See example plot below. 

**==> picture [135 x 33] intentionally omitted <==**

**----- Start of picture text -----**<br>
3s<br>150%<br>7s<br>**----- End of picture text -----**<br>


If the peak load is less than 150%, the duration of the peak can be longer than 3s before the output turns off, for example, a peak load of 130% could typically be taken for up to 13s and a peak load of 140% could typically be taken for up to 5s. The off duration is always approximately 7s. 

Average power is not to exceed nominal output power.
